The following information should help you understand the cost of attending college. Keep in mind that most students receive a financial aid package (grants and scholarships) which lowers their out-of-pocket cost. This is reflected on the net price information, if available.
Living On-Campus
18,887
Living Off-Campus
18,887
Living with Family
16,987
The amounts above pertain to first-time full-time undergraduate students and include tuition and fees, housing and meals, transportation, and personal expenses. Use these estimated amounts as a reference for building your annual budget for attending this institution.
Average Net Price $11,356 / year

This is the average annual amount that first-time, full-time undergraduate students pay at this institution after subtracting all grants and scholarships from the cost of attendance.

The data displayed below comes from the Graduate Employment Outcomes tool and only reports on graduates employed in Minnesota. This section shows employment data for graduate class of 2017, including percent of graduates with full-time employment in the 3rd year after college graduation and the median annual wages by award level, according to the Minnesota unemployment insurance records. Data does not include federal employees, self-employed (e.g. professional freelancers, artists, developers, designers, business owners), military, or individuals who moved out of state for a job. The list below may be incomplete and limited to some majors. Additionally, data has been suppressed when it refers to 10 or less students.Jump to:
Certificates / Diplomas
Field of Study Percent Employed Full-time 3 Years Post-Graduation Median Annual Salary of Graduates
Construction Trades, General 63% $50,936
Electrical and Power Transmission Installers 63% $50,936
Electrical and Power Transmission Installers 63% $50,936
Engineering technologies and engineering-related fields 74% $57,487
Health professions and related programs 17% $38,366
Industrial Production Technologies/Technicians 78% $57,487
Mechanic and repair technologies/technicians 77% $39,225
Practical Nursing, Vocational Nursing and Nursing Assistants 14% $38,277
Practical Nursing, Vocational Nursing and Nursing Assistants 14% $38,277
Associate Degree
Field of Study Percent Employed Full-time 3 Years Post-Graduation Median Annual Salary of Graduates
Business Administration, Management and Operations 64% $44,192
Business, management, marketing, and related support services 56% $43,218
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science/Research and Allied Professions 91% $46,530
Health Services/Allied Health/Health Sciences, General 42% $59,170
Liberal arts and sciences, general studies and humanities 22% $39,439
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ities 22% $39,439
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ing 40% $65,037
